Microsoft has alerted Windows 11 users about a new experimental AI feature called the “Proxy Server,” introduced in build 26220.7262, which can be manually activated in the “AI Components” section. Users receive a cautionary message regarding the feature's experimental nature and potential impacts on device performance, including inaccuracies and unexpected behavior. The underlying language model is still in development, leading to risks of inaccuracies due to incomplete training data. Experts have raised concerns about vulnerabilities to cyber threats, with reports of cybercriminals exploring ways to exploit the AI features. The “Proxy Server” has default read and write permissions to critical user directories, raising security concerns. Microsoft plans to enhance security measures with more granular permission controls and advises that the feature should only be enabled by users aware of the associated risks.

Samsung faces criticism for allegations that certain budget-friendly Galaxy A and M smartphones are preloaded with unremovable spyware, particularly affecting users in the Middle East and North Africa. The Lebanese digital rights organization SMEX has highlighted a pre-installed application called AppCloud on some Galaxy A and M devices sold in Saudi Arabia, the UAE, and Egypt. AppCloud, developed by ironSource, collects sensitive user data without explicit consent during device setup and is difficult to uninstall, often reinstalling after a device reset. Concerns have been raised about its potential use for surveillance and targeted cyberattacks, especially in politically sensitive areas. SMEX has called for increased transparency from Samsung, which has not yet responded. Independent research validating these claims about AppCloud's impact on privacy is currently lacking.

Google has launched a "Developer Verification" initiative requiring developers to verify their identities when distributing applications outside the Google Play Store. This program aims to enhance user safety while allowing advanced users to install unverified apps. The early access phase has begun, with invitations for Play Store developers starting November 25, 2025. Simplified verification pathways will be available for students and hobbyists. Advanced users can still sideload apps but will receive explicit warnings about potential risks. The initiative seeks to reduce the distribution of malware by increasing the complexity and cost for malicious developers, while maintaining user choice for technically skilled individuals.

Rockstar Games' Grand Theft Auto V and GTA Online have been officially released in Saudi Arabia and the United Arab Emirates, receiving a new 21+ age rating from the General Authority for Media Regulation and the UAE Media Council. This approval allows local gamers to purchase and enjoy the game legally, marking a shift towards more progressive content regulation in the region. Previously, the game was inaccessible due to its portrayal of violence, sex, and drug use. Over 90% of PC and console players in Saudi Arabia, the UAE, and Egypt are over the age of 21, and the gaming market in these countries is projected to grow significantly by 2029. Additionally, Take-Two Interactive has established a partnership with the Saudi-based Advanced Initiative Company for local distribution of its major franchises, including GTA V. The approval comes ahead of the anticipated release of Grand Theft Auto 6 on May 9, 2026, which is expected to launch in the region without previous regulatory delays. As of May 2025, GTA V has sold over 215 million copies worldwide.

Microsoft's Windows 11 has become the most widely adopted desktop operating system, capturing 52% of the market share, while Windows 10 holds 44.59%. Windows 11 is operational on over 400 million devices, taking two years to reach this milestone compared to one year for Windows 10. The slower adoption of Windows 11 is attributed to its stringent hardware requirements. Microsoft is offering one additional year of security updates for Windows 10 users at no cost, provided they enable Windows Backup and synchronize their Documents folder with OneDrive; otherwise, a fee will be required for updates.

1312 Interactive has completed its pre-seed founding round, establishing itself as India's first dedicated PC and console game publishing house, founded by Deepak Gurijala and Raviteja Mantena. The company aims to discover and publish indie and AA games for global audiences and has received support from industry leaders, including Akshat Rathee, Gautam Virk, Rajat Ojha, and others. The founders plan to elevate Indian games in the global market and are exploring collaborations with developers in Southeast Asia, the MENA region, and South America. They have three titles scheduled for release in 2025: Winds of Arcana, Palm Sugar: A Village Story, and Souls of Bombarika, with plans to introduce six to eight additional games annually.

Cat's Vote is a resource management simulation game developed by Danar Kayfi, set to launch on Steam next month. The game combines themes of cats and politics, allowing players to manage resources for a feline family while participating in elections that influence their living conditions. A demo is currently available during the Steam Next Fest, which runs until October 21st. The game was originally conceived during the 2017 Game Zanga game jam and has been revisited for its formal release in 2024. Danar Kayfi will also attend Pocket Gamer Connects Jordan on November 9th and 10th.

Eneba has partnered with game publishers Riot Games and Garena to enhance its PC marketplace. This collaboration allows mobile game publishers to utilize Eneba’s digital marketplace for co-promotions and improved fraud protection. Eneba now offers Riot Cash digital currency in the U.S., Canada, and most of Latin America, enabling purchases of in-game content for Riot Games titles. Additionally, Eneba will start offering Garena Shells in mid-September for purchasing in-game content for titles like Garena Free Fire. Eneba has over 80,000 digital gaming products and has attracted over 15 million buyers in 2023, with a high customer return rate. Founded in 2018, Eneba has a team of over 250 professionals.

Warner Bros has announced the shutdown of Harry Potter: Magic Awakened in the Americas, Europe, and Oceania, effective October 29, just over a year after its global launch in July 2023. The game will remain accessible in Asia, including the Chinese Mainland, Hong Kong, Macau, Taiwan, and select territories in MENA. It has been removed from the App Store and Google Play, and in-game purchases have been halted. Players can continue to play until the servers go offline. There are challenges for players considering transitioning to NetEase servers, as this would result in a loss of progress. The closure contrasts with the success of Hogwarts Legacy, which was noted as the best-selling game of the year in early 2024. Warner Bros aims to focus on mobile and multi-platform free-to-play games, but the quick closure raises questions about this strategy.
